Pei Zheng et al. found that the nitrogen-induced changes in #SoilEnvironment and #MicrobiaActivity substantially affected the litter quality, underlined that #NitrogenAddition suppressed long-term decomposition and may sequester #SoilCarbon in #TemperateMeadowSteppe.

Baoyu Sun et al. quantified the causal relationships between plants ( #GrossPrimaryProductivity, GPP) in a #CoastalWetland and #SoilEnvironment (e.g. soil temperature, moisture and salinity). The findings revealed that warming amplified the interaction between GPP, and #SoilSalinity in the #CoastalWetlandEcosystem.
